Team Supervisor

4 weeks ago


Dorchester, United Kingdom Dorset County Hospital NHS Foundation Trust Full time

To be responsible for the supervision, management and allocation of a multi-disciplined workforce and resources undertaking work associated with all engineering plant, building fabric and equipment to the estate within the Trust’s Establishments. Provide technical support to estates staff and contractors on issues that are complex and non-routine. Follow departmental and Trusts operating policies and procedures guided by building and H & S regulations when undertaking this role and works closely with the Estates Officer but also independently without regular supervision

To directly supervise the multi-disciplined direct labour force including monitoring, timekeeping and discipline.

To negotiate with departments for access to allow repairs to be undertaken explaining technical issues to non -technical staff.

To manage and plan access to departments for maintenance contractors, ensure that H & S procedures are documented keys and permits issued.

Provide quotations to other departments based on time and material costs.

To plan maintenance activities including staff rotas and overtime works, source supplies using technical knowledge of electrical, mechanical and building materials and processes

To assist Estates Officer in the maintenance of stock and supplies for the Estates Department.

To collect, collate and assimilate technical information to support the departments governance records of maintenance activities.

To be able to prioritise urgent and non-urgent repairs using knowledge of electrical, mechanical and building systems.

The post holder will have responsibility for providing a technical engineering advice and support for the maintenance of equipment, fabric and utility services for the trust. Supervises / manages direct labour force and contractors together with:
To monitor the completion of time sheets and job dockets, including reporting any performance issues to the Estates Officer. To undertake return to work interviews following staff absences due to sickness.

To ensure that safety procedures are observed in the use of Plant Equipment, Materials and Working Procedures and ensure that a safe working environment is maintained at all times in accordance with Health & Safety Regulation.

To work outside his/her trade in the event of an emergency or as directed by the Estates Officer/Head of Estates

To take part in an emergency on-call rota

Any other duties as delegated by the Estates Officer relevant to the post/department.

To participate in appropriate training as required by this position and determined by the Estates Management Staff.

Responsibility for Patients

To assist patients during incidental contact

Responsibility for Policy and Service Development

To implement new and revised policies and changes in estates services and where appropriate review estates policies.

Responsibility for Financial and Physical Resources

To be an authorised signatory for payments, to monitor project budgets associated with the repair and maintenance of physical assets.

Responsibility for Information Resources

To be able to enter data associated with stores maintenance and to process job requests via the Estates electronic request system. To analyse these using technical knowledge to update records including creating own spreadsheets to his / her area of work and to enter data.

Responsibility for Research and Development

To undertake surveys or audits as necessary to your own work

Physical Skills

To accurately use highly developed physical skills in the use of fine tools, materials and equipment.

Analytical & Judgement Skills

Taking account of H & S and current legislation undertake fault diagnosis, interprets technical information, formulates technical solutions to improve equipment performance and to analyse suitability of equipment together with interpret operational manuals.

Planning & Organisational Skills

To plan, prioritise and adjust a number of complex activities or programmes, liaising with user, contractors and specialist agencies together with adjustment of staffing levels.
